Output 17715d15915e74902f01a09a0fb136796314733baea14bbd290ee87f93f5622e:1

value
999100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a34b5893fa2e44d067ddc1ebae099afaa77338 OP_EQUAL
address
2MyW9ZDXFRa38NaPfZHQs6PSBeBZ4ZPpEkA
transaction
17715d15915e74902f01a09a0fb136796314733baea14bbd290ee87f93f5622e